    Sciatica is discomfort that begins in your lower back and shoots down through your legs and in some cases into your feet. It happens when something in your body-- perhaps a herniated disk or bone spur compresses your sciatic nerve. Some individuals experience sharp, extreme pain, and others get tingling, weakness, and feeling numb in their legs.

    The majority of people with sciatica do not end up requiring surgical treatment, and about half improve within 6 weeks with only rest and medication. Lots of people believe that alternative therapies like yoga, massage, biofeedback, and acupuncture help with sciatica. Yourvery first choice ought to be over-the-counter painkiller. Acetaminophen and NSAIDs( nonsteroidal anti-inflammatory drugs) like aspirin, ibuprofen, and naproxen are very valuable, however you should not use them for extended durations without talking toyour physician. Tricyclic antidepressants such as amitriptyline( Elavil )and anti- seizure medications often work, too.

    Steroid injections straight into the irritated nerve can likewise supply you with restricted relief. Whenall else stops working, surgery is the last option for about 5% to 10% of people with sciatica.
